Transaction 762c24ca5c95676cd9a815177f4d1cb51399f321c6a25737642feeeab76b6938
1 Input
1 Output
-
762c24ca5c95676cd9a815177f4d1cb51399f321c6a25737642feeeab76b6938:0
- value
- 79662
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4f07073074025decfb358c92185ed7bcc2e09f1
- address
- bc1qcnc8quc8gqjaanantryjrp0d00xzuz03yz58vs